Almost every set of Nge d+1 orthogonal states on d^(otimes n) is locally indistinguishable

I consider the problem of deterministically distinguishing the state of a multipartite system, from a set of $N\ge d+1$ orthogonal states, where $d$ is the dimension of each party's subsystem. It is shown that if the set of orthogonal states is chosen at random, then there is a vanishing probability that this set will be perfectly distinguishable under the restriction that the parties use only local operations on their subsystems and classical communication amongst themselves.
